Fragment of an eye of Horus (wedjat) amulet

Egyptian
Late Period
760–332 B.C.
Findspot: Egypt, Giza, Debris East of Pyramid I-b

Medium/Technique Faience
Dimensions Height x width x depth: 1.4 x 1.2 x 0.8 cm (9/16 x 1/2 x 5/16 in.)
Credit Line Harvard University—Boston Museum of Fine Arts Expedition
Accession Number24.2276
NOT ON VIEW
ClassificationsJewelry / AdornmentAmulets

DescriptionFragment of faience, green, eye of Horus (wedjat) amulet.
ProvenanceFrom Giza, Debris East of Pyramid I-b. 1924: excavated by the Harvard University–Museum of Fine Arts Expedition; assigned to the MFA by the government of Egypt.
